Saipem is a global leader in engineering and construction for energy and infrastructure projects, both offshore and onshore. Organized into five business lines—Asset Based Services, Energy Carriers, Offshore Wind, Sustainable Infrastructures, Robotics Industrialized Solutions—Saipem operates 8 fabrication yards, an offshore fleet of 29 vessels (26 owned, 3 managed by third parties), and 15 drilling rigs (8 owned). Committed to technological innovation and environmental sustainability, Saipem aims for a sustainable future and supports clients' energy transition towards Net Zero, leveraging digital technologies and processes. Listed on the Milan Stock Exchange, Saipem has a presence in over 50 countries and employs approximately 30,000 people from more than 120 nationalities.

As a Production Planner, you will join the Fabrication Control Management (FABCOM) Department within the ABSER Business Line, and your activities will include:
During bidding phase: Support the definition of procurement and fabrication strategies, project scheduling, and man-hour estimation based on bidding documentation and data on material utilization, yields, and workload.
At project start-up: Support the project team in releasing the project schedule related to fabrication activities, defining engineering and procurement deliverable dates; contribute to the preparation of work breakdown structures and ensure the issuance of estimated man-hours.
During project execution: Ensure cycled man-hours preparation and operative planning; monitor actual vs. cycled man-hours, producing ETC analyses; support decision-making regarding project modifications; ensure timely upload of project data and feedback; support continuous improvement; coordinate pre-fabrication and fabrication activities; develop multi-project production plans; issue the project execution plan; evaluate subcontractor claims in terms of time and cost impacts.
